The objective of the Trust is to fund specialist educational programmes, vital in improving the learning development of these fantastic children. Ultimately this will enable them to integrate fully into the community, living productive and dignified lives. It can make the difference between them being productive, contributing members of society, rather than being dependant on public resources for their entire lives. The impact of this education has been well documented in various international university studies - it is literally life changing. With assistance we can remove financial barriers for families, so that the children can benefit from the program. Without financial assistance many of the families would be unable to afford the cost of the speech therapy programs. Down Syndrome is the most common chromosomal disability in New Zealand. These kids live in our communities the length and breadth of our nation.
 
Our work is ongoing, and children attend speech therapy sessions every fortnight. The benefits of children with Down Syndrome in attending this speech therapy is

We would provide financial assistance to families with Children with Down Syndrome, so that the children can participate in the speech therapy program which in unaffordable to most families. Children participating in this speech program are receiving the best possible start in life, the outcome for the children is that they are achieving their potential, developing communication skills that are invaluable for them to communicate with others.
 
We, as New Zealanders are proud to live in a society which makes education available to all. Unfortunately the extra education that makes such a profound difference to these little guys in not available through the public education system. Because they come into the world with a distinct disadvantage they need an extra leg up in order to reach their potential. That is what the trust does, and we hope you will help us to deliver independence and a greater sense of self worth to these kids
